Poland, Czech Republic, Austria
28, 29 September 2013
The border crossing was slow but that was mainly due to the volume of traffic going through. It will be our last one before flying home as we are now in the EU.
As we drove into Poland we could see it was more prosperous with better roads, better maintained towns and villages, no dogs wandering about and no more Ladas or Kamaz truck. I guess its definitely Europe. We passed a lot of modern churches prior to arriving in Cracow and finding accommodation in the Kazimierz area.
Monday 30 September
We spent a relaxed day walking on the cobblestones around Wawel Hill with the castle and palace and then on to other sites of the old town of Cracow. We also bought 3rd party insurance for the truck.

Tuesday 1 October
We went down the Wieliczka salt mine just south of Cracow. Interesting long history, extensive, amazing sculpture and structure but over the years the mine has become a polished tourist destination losing a lot of its charm.
Maybe I need a break.

2, 3 October
As we drove through the rolling hills and forests of the Czech Republic, we passed through Oloumac, a vibrant university town and Telc. Both towns having well restored town squares.
By chance we turned off the road to camp and ended up camping in the Czech Grand Prix carpark.

4, 5 October
Finally arrived at Cesky Krumlov, the last highlight of the trip and one we had been looking forward to. Clear skies added to the attractive sight of the castle and town. We found accommodation in one of the narrowest buildings in the Czech Republic, a restored medieval home with a chapel in the front and rediscovered the town.
